The Assembly Education Committee reports favorably Assembly Bill No. 4859.
This bill provides that, beginning with the 2022-2023 school year, all candidates for teaching certification who have completed an educator preparation program at a commissioner-approved educator preparation program provider must have satisfactorily completed a course or training on remote teaching that includes, but is not limited to, information on:
(1) revising curriculum for an online platform;
(2) the most effective tools available for content delivery;
(3) creating opportunities for student engagement and discussion;
(4) building and sustaining community and connection with, and among, students; and
(5) delivering assessments online and monitoring academic progress.
The bill also provides that all commissioner-approved educator preparation program providers review and update their educator preparation programs to implement the bill’s requirements and submit the revisions to the Department of Education for approval.
